During the exam, the psychiatrist will interview you about your life and discuss the symptoms you are experiencing. You will be asked about your family history and any mental health issues you might have. To ensure a thorough evaluation, be honest about your answers. Some patients might be nervous about their first appointment with a psychiatrist. These doctors are trained to make patients feel safe and comfortable. They can answer any questions you might have and put your worries at ease.

Your doctor will determine whether you qualify for a shared-care contract with NHS after the assessment. This means that the private clinic will send a letter to your GP with the paperwork required for a shared care arrangement. This will permit you to go back to the NHS for additional treatment and care if necessary.

i-want-great-care-logo.pngGetting an ADHD diagnosis as an adult can be a challenge and a majority of GPs will not refer you to an expert. You can make an appointment on your own through the NHS's Right to Choose programme. This will allow you access to an assessment and treatment without a GP's referral letter. Some providers will accept an agreement to share care with your doctor so that you can access treatment on the NHS and only pay the prescription fee. However, not all doctors will agree to this arrangement.

The process of obtaining an ADHD diagnosis is a complex and time-consuming, and may require a lengthy interview with a mental health professional. The evaluation typically includes questionnaires and psychological testing that are based on how an person perceives their behavior. The evaluation also includes rating scales that evaluate the performance of a person in various social situations. It is suggested that a significant person in your life, such as a spouse or family member will complete the questionnaires along together with you.
